Wilson Electric Company on Cusp of its Centennial
It is somewhat ironic and remarkable that Wilson Electric Company is a year away from celebrating its 100th consecutive year of operation while NIBCA marks that milestone in 2018.
Wilson is owned and operated by four partners with Louie Maffioli acting as President. Louie serves as Governor of the local National Electrical Contractors Assoc. (NECA) chapter as well as Co-Chairman of Project First Rate, a Labor-Management consortium.
Joining Louie are partners, Paul Maffioli and Steve Drummond (Vice-Presidents) and Joel Kortemeier, CFO. The next generation at Wilson Electric is represented by Nik Maffioli, estimator/project manager.

Emil Maffioli and Paul Wilson started Maffioli-Wilson Electric in 1919.
